Ordinals
beta
Sat 1257549270784468
decimal
293019.1770784468
degree
0°83019′699″1770784468‴
percentile
59.88329867465585%
name
eydegbfxzxd
cycle
0
epoch
1
period
145
block
293019
offset
1770784468
timestamp
2014-03-29 05:03:03 UTC
rarity
common
prev
next